After our departure, we visit Spalding, a Lincolnshire market town, before continuing to our hotel.

Today's first stop is Snettisham Park, a three-hundred-acre working farm. Our visit includes a spectacular wildlife safari for an encounter with the magnificent free-roaming red deer herd. You'll have the opportunity to get up close and personal with these majestic creatures, and you might even get to feed them! From here, we continue onto Sandringham, the much-loved country retreat of the Royal Family. Your admission into this stunning estate includes access to the house, which consists of a complete multimedia tour, magnificent gardens, and the transport museum.

This morning, we travel to the elegant resort of Hunstanton or 'Hunston' as it's known locally. Renowned for its unique striped cliffs and magnificent sunsets, this seaside town is a purpose-built resort and has retained its splendid Victorian charm and character. From the excellent beach to the tranquil retreat of the Esplanade Gardens, there's something for everyone to enjoy! We return to the hotel for an afternoon at leisure; why not treat yourself to afternoon tea on the garden terrace or enjoy use of the hotel's onsite leisure facilities? Alternatively, you can make your own way to Castle Rising Castle, one of the most famous twelfth-century castles in England, just a short ten-minute taxi ride away.

We enjoy a leisurely morning at our spa hotel before an afternoon excursion to Burnham Market. Regarded as the area's loveliest village, Burnham Market is a popular haunt of the rich and royalty, as evidenced by the "By Royal Appointment" signs above many of the local independent shops.

Our final full-day excursion involves a visit to Wells-next-the-Sea, one of the loveliest seaside towns on the North Norfolk Coast with a rich fishing history. After time to explore chic shops, eateries and art galleries, we board the Wells & Walsingham Light Railway, the world’s smallest public railway for a nostalgic journey through the beautiful countryside to Walsingham. One of the most extraordinary villages in the British Isles, Walsingham is steeped in history with its collection of rare half-timbered medieval buildings. We enjoy free time to explore this beautiful location, considered a site of holy pilgrimage for over a century and home to both a ruined priory and the Holy House.

This morning, we pay a short visit to Norfolk Lavender, home to a famous farm shop and Lavender distillery before we return home.
